UDAYAPUR, Nov 25: Rajan Kirati (Basu) of the CPN (Maoist Center) has won the provincial assembly election from Udaipur-1 (A). According to the final results of the counting which ended at 10:25 in the morning, Kirati, a candidate of the ruling alliance, started his journey as a member of the Provincial Assembly by getting 15,092 votes.

UDAYAPUR, July 18: The Siwai bridge which was completed after almost 12 years of construction went out of commission two weeks ago after getting severely damaged by the flood in the Triyuga River in Chaudandigadi Municipality-5 in Udayapur district. Also, two additional pillars and three slabs of the bridge which connects Siwai and Belhi were washed away by the flood following incessant rainfall since Saturday morning.
